Skyline University Nigeria Hosts Teacher Training Initiative for Kano State Government School Teachers

Skyline University Nigeria (SUN) is progressing with its teacher training initiative, a corporate social responsibility (CSR) project in collaboration with the RMK Foundation.

The program aims to empower 1000 government school teachers in Kano State with effective teaching pedagogies and digital skills.

The initiative, which commenced earlier this year, has already hosted the 2nd batch of teachers and is currently training the 3rd batch. The training sessions are designed to enhance the teachers' performance, promoting improved educational outcomes for students in Kano State.

By equipping teachers with modern teaching methods and digital skills, SUN and the RMK Foundation are contributing to the development of a more effective and efficient education system in the state.
